Keelaghan has become something of an institution in Alberta, and at the Festival -- he closed our Festival in 1993.
Over his more than 10-year career, he has produced four albums which have also garnered audience and industry acclaim. My Skies received a JUNO Award in 1994 for 'Best Roots and Traditional Album', and was also voted 'Best Album of 1993' in a Vancouver readers' poll.
Keelaghan's latest album, A Recent Future, was also nominated for a JUNO in the 'Best Roots and Traditional Album' category. The work is described as "his most spirited and political yet."
In addition to the Festival, he's played mainstages around the world, including Vancouver, Winnipeg, Kerrville, as well as Tonder (Denmark), the Australian National Festival and the Hong Kong Folk Festival.
